Abstract
A thermoplastic polyurethane elastomer is disclosed obtained by reacting A) diisocyanates, B) polyhydroxy compounds and/or polyamines, with C) as chain extenders mixtures of C1) benzene substituted with at least two hydroxyalkyl, hydroxyalkoxy, aminoalkyl and/or aminoalkoxy groups and C2) an alkanediol with 4 to 44 C atoms. The reaction is further characterized in that the molar ratio C1:C2 = 60:40 to 95:5 and in that the equivalent ratio of NCO groups to the sum of the NCO-reactive groups is about 0.9 to 1.20
